skip to main content

Important Notice

It appears you are using an older version of your browser. While some functions will be available, Delaware JobLink works best with a modern browser such as the ones provided by:

Please download and install the latest version of the browser of your choice. We apologize for any inconvenience.



Software Engineering - Technical Lead

Click the Facebook, Google+ or LinkedIn icons to share this job with your friends or contacts. Click the Twitter icon to tweet this job to your followers. Click the link button to view the URL of the job, which then can be copied and pasted into an e-mail or other document.

Job Details
Job Order Number
JC170130667
Company Name
Citigroup
Physical Address

New Castle, DE 19720
Job Description

This Full Stack Technical manager will be responsible to lead the software development and provide support for both technical and business office related activities, which are essential in ensuring smooth delivery of Trade and Treasury Solutions Digital technology service to business. He/she requires exceptional communication skills across both technology and the business and will have a high degree of visibility. The candidate will be a rigorous technical lead with a strong understanding of how to build global, modern, scalable, enterprise level applications. The ideal candidate will be dependable and resourceful software professional who can comfortably work with multiple agile engineering teams in a globally distributed, dynamic work environment that fosters diversity, teamwork and collaboration. The ability to work in high-pressured environment is essential. The Full Stack technical lead is a senior level position responsible for establishing and implementing new or revised user interfaces application systems and programs in coordination with the Technology team. The overall objective of this role is to lead applications systems analysis and programming activities. Responsibilities: Partner with multiple engineering teams to ensure appropriate integration of functions to meet goals as well as identify and define necessary system enhancements to deploy new products, business features and process improvements Resolve variety of high impact problems/projects through in-depth evaluation of complex technical challenges, business processes, system processes, and industry standards Provide expertise in area and advanced knowledge of applications programming and ensure application design adheres to the overall architecture blueprint Utilize advanced knowledge of system flow and develop standards for coding, testing, debugging, and implementation Develop comprehensive knowledge of how areas of software engineering, business, architecture and infrastructure integrate to accomplish business goals Provide in-depth analysis with interpretive thinking to define issues and develop innovative solutions Serve as technical advisor or coach to mid-level developers and analysts, allocating work as necessary Appropriately assess risk when business and technical decisions are made, demonstrating particular consideration for the balance of technology innovation, firm’s reputation and safeguarding Citigroup, its clients and assets, by driving compliance with applicable laws, rules and regulations, adhering to Policy, applying sound ethical judgment regarding personal behavior, conduct and business practices, and escalating, managing and reporting control issues with transparency. Qualifications: 14+ years of relevant work experience, with minimum 5 years of experience leading projects and technical design. Agile knowledge, preferably scrum and SAFe framework JavaScript/Java/Oracle/NoSQL/Cloud/Docker/MicroService Implementation. Able to drive technical discussions. Technical / Functional Proficiency: The candidate should have proven record of accomplishment implementing a financial transaction system with significant volumes. Experience with JavaScript/Angular Experience with Java/Spring (Cloud/Boot) Framework Database experience with (Oracle/MongoDB/NoSQL) Experience with development and CI/CD tools like JavaScript/Java IDE, Git, bitbucket, Sonar, Jira, TeamCity and Jenkins etc. Strong understanding of Java concurrency, concurrency patterns, experience building thread safe code Experience with TDD, code testability standards, JUnit Experience with Microservice with API Gateway Management tools, Docker Container/ Kubernetes, Apache Kafka and Couchbase Service architectures (REST & SOAP), API Gateway Management tools, Knowledge of Web security frameworks and various Vulnerability Assessment tools would be advantageous Experience in Financial industry and Payments applications and processes would be advantageous Leadership Skills: Excellent organization skills, attention to detail, and ability to multi-task Excellent communication skills. Clearly, articulating and documenting technical and functional specifications is a key requirement. Negotiation, difficult conversation management and prioritization skills Promotes teamwork and builds strong relationships within and across global teams Education: BS or MS Degree in Computer Science, Information Technology, or equivalent This job description provides a high-level review of the types of work performed. Other job-related duties may be assigned as required. Citi USA is an equal opportunity employer. Accordingly, we will make accommodations to respond to the needs of people with disabilities (including, without limitation, physical and mental health disabilities) during the recruitment process and otherwise in accordance with law. Individuals who view themselves as Aboriginals, members of visible minority or racialized communities, and people with disabilities are encouraged to apply. -——————————————————————— Job Family Group: Technology -——————————————————————— Job Family: Applications Development -—————————————————————————- Time Type: Full time -—————————————————————————- Citi is an equal opportunity and affirmative action employer. Qualified applicants will receive consideration without regard to their race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ran. Citigroup Inc. and its subsidiaries (“Citi”) invite all qualified interested applicants to apply for career opportunities. If you are a person with a disability and need a reasonable accommodation to use our search tools and/or apply for a career opportunity review Accessibility at Citi . View the " EEO is the Law " poster. View the EEO is the Law Supplement . View the EEO Policy Statement . View the Pay Transparency Posting

Citi is an equal opportunity and affirmative action employer.
Minority/Female/Veteran/Individuals with Disabilities/Sexual Orientation/Gender Identity.


To view full details and how to apply, please login or create a Job Seeker account.